Petitioner challenged order u/s 73 of GST Act creating demand, as notices were uploaded on GST portal's 'Additional Notices and Orders' tab, unbeknownst to petitioner who couldn't appear or question orders within limitation period. Referring to OLA FLEET case, where impugned order wasn't reflected under 'View Notices and Orders' tab and assessee's replies weren't considered, High Court quashed impugned orders dated 27.12.2023 and 02.02.2023 passed by Assistant Commissioner. Petitioner allowed to treat impugned order as final notice and submit reply within two weeks, as disputed amount deposited with government and no outstanding demand exists.
